Transaction a8dd23f71b3a2c8428c80528b80ef4a103ecc79fb3785d5220a2549352f92e15

7 Input
2 Outputs
  • a8dd23f71b3a2c8428c80528b80ef4a103ecc79fb3785d5220a2549352f92e15:0
  • value  153330000
    address  18s4NMXPyBERGTSGYt6td7KzE53STYcB47
  • a8dd23f71b3a2c8428c80528b80ef4a103ecc79fb3785d5220a2549352f92e15:1
  • value  131867250
    address  16UXjWNAnMzik3CFjeKLmCXnp6f2Q8xyUA